Dinteloord en omliggende gemeenten » Coenraedt Kom (1680-????)

Personal data Coenraedt Kom 

  • He was born in the year 1680.
  • This information was last updated on May 27, 2021.

Household of Coenraedt Kom

He is married to Bastiaentje Tuenis Kas.

They got married on April 14, 1717 at Middelharnis, Zuid-Holland, Nederland, he was 37 years old.


Child(ren):

  1. Cornelis Kom  1725-1775
